Chris@1051 24 /** Frame index, the unit of our time axis. This is signed because the
Chris@1051 25 axis conceptually extends below zero: zero represents the start of
Chris@1051 26 the main loaded audio model, not the start of time; a windowed
Chris@1051 27 transform could legitimately produce results before then. We also
Chris@1051 28 use this for frame counts, simply to avoid error-prone arithmetic
Chris@1051 29 between signed and unsigned types.
Chris@1051 30 */
Chris@1049 31 typedef int64_t sv_frame_t;

Chris@1051 33 /** Check whether an integer index is in range for a container,
Chris@1051 34 avoiding overflows and signed/unsigned comparison warnings.
Chris@1051 35 */
Chris@1049 36 template<typename T, typename C>
Chris@1049 37 bool in_range_for(const C &container, T i)
Chris@1049 38 {
Chris@1049 39 if (i < 0) return false;
Chris@1049 40 if (sizeof(T) > sizeof(typename C::size_type)) {
Chris@1429 41 return i < static_cast<T>(container.size());
Chris@1049 42 } else {
Chris@1429 43 return static_cast<typename C::size_type>(i) < container.size();
Chris@1049 44 }
Chris@1049 45 }

Chris@1051 47 /** Sample rate. We have to deal with sample rates provided as float
Chris@1051 48 or (unsigned) int types, so we might as well have a type that can
Chris@1051 49 represent both. Storage size isn't an issue anyway.
Chris@1051 50 */
Chris@1051 51 typedef double sv_samplerate_t;
